Ferrari 812 Replacement Engines

The Ferrari 812 Superfast (2017-2023) and its open-top sibling, the 812 GTS (2019-2023), are powered exclusively by the F140 GA 6.5L V12 engine-Ferrari’s most powerful naturally aspirated production engine to date. Unlike turbocharged contemporaries, the 812’s high-revving architecture (8,500 rpm redline) places extreme thermal and mechanical stress on cylinder heads and valve trains. Common failure points include warped cylinder heads due to sustained high-load operation and premature camshaft lobe wear, particularly in pre-2020 models. While no official Ferrari Service Bulletin addresses these issues directly, independent specialists confirm recurring patterns linked to oil viscosity degradation under track conditions. All 812s use the same F140 GA block (internal code F140GA), with no diesel or hybrid variants-making engine replacement uniquely straightforward yet technically demanding due to precision tolerances.
